当前位置:首页 >> 资讯

计算机程序设计能力参加考试(PAT)备考通 | PAT参加考试大纲解读

来源:资讯   2024年01月19日 12:17

变换时会使服务器端构造不够明晰易懂,这在软件系统上是非常极为重要的。

特别注意:大公司在甄选人才时似乎时会妥当查阅笔试提交的编译器,技术主管一般时会不够赞赏有极佳专业平常的笔试。

5

祖母绿八段

考生墨迹目一般有 7道,如下示意所示。

(1)两道 5分墨迹、两边 10分墨迹、两边 15分墨迹和两道 20分墨迹,与的唱片八段的实地考察点完全相同,才会赘述。

(2)终于两道 25分墨迹就其最简单URL和等长URL启发式。

URL是根基启发式之一,一般笔试时会在“数据资料构造”文凭中的学习到多种精华的URL启发式,用做所求决相同情况下的URL问墨迹。对于学习了根基程序内部设计精准的笔试,本墨迹也就是说引人特别注意实地考察笔试对多种URL启发式的所求读,只要笔试时会常用一门程序内部设计语言中的的道区别于URL库formula_(如 C语言中的的 qsortformula_)即可。

等长URL也是根基启发式,笔试应精准把握该启发式的构建。

2

乙级考生纲要阐释

乙级考生互换“巨匠”八段,全面性实地考察笔试的都有战斗能力:

也就是说的 C/C++语言编译器内部设计战斗能力,以及相关开发生态的也就是说复用精准;

所求读并把握最也就是说的数据资料磁盘构造,即嵌套、堆栈;

所求读并精准程序内部设计构建与也就是说数据资料构造相关的根基启发式,仅限于递归、URL、URL等;

都能归纳启发式的时长线性、尺度线性和启发式耐用性;

不具初级的问墨迹抽象和数据资料归纳战斗能力,并都能用所学方法所求决单单问墨迹。

乙级考生一般有 5道墨迹,其中的,最最简单的两道墨迹为 15分,尚有三道 20分墨迹,终于两道是 25分墨迹。

从实地考察点来看,乙级比根基级“祖母绿”八段的实地考察降低了两个极为重要的方点,主要纤现在后两边墨迹中的。终于两道 25分墨迹似乎就其“数据资料构造”文凭才时会详述讲所求的线性表构造(嵌套和堆栈,仅限于栈和队列等运用)的妥善处理,如后面的例墨迹 1示意所示;或者在多个所求决方案中的,敦促笔试只有给显现出时长线性最少的所求才能得到差评,如后面的例墨迹 2示意所示。

与根基级“祖母绿”八段相对于,乙级考生才会有 5分、 10分这种跟上平衡性的墨迹目,而是反之亦然从 15分起,提极低了投球的下限。根基级“祖母绿”八段能得到 90分的笔试,在乙级考生中的一般可以得到 60分以上的总分。

乙级考生笔试不仅要都能写下显现出一个服务器端以所求决问墨迹,而且无需很强启发式的时长线性、尺度线性和启发式耐用性的概念,都能写下显现出成本应有极低的服务器端。如例墨迹 2中的的问墨迹就有多种所求出,拟合所求只无需 O(N)的时长线性,给显现出时长线性为 O(N 2 )启发式的笔试虽然也可以投球,但得不了差评。

所有墨迹目都旨在实地考察笔试的区域性程序内部设计战斗能力,而不是单一方点的把握,因此才能得到大公司的赞许。

3

甲级考生纲要阐释

甲级考生互换“战将”八段,在乙级考生的细化,还全面性实地考察笔试的都有战斗能力:

应有的英文名称学习者角度看;

所求读并把握根基数据资料构造,仅限于线性表、树是、所示;

所求读并精准程序内部设计构建精华低级启发式,仅限于校验同态、并查集、最粗壮路径、紧致URL、关键路径、贪心、深达优先、广度优先、说明了了剪枝等;

不具较爆冷的问墨迹抽象和数据资料归纳战斗能力,能构建对适合于单单问墨迹的精心内部设计求所求。

首先,甲级考生的墨迹目描绘常用英文名称,且考生中的不意味着笔试查字典——当然,显现出墨迹者也时会为个别比较生僻的单词标显现出译者。这对笔试的英文名称学习者角度看提显现出了较极低敦促。之所以这样特设,是因为计数机行业其发展不断,这就敦促从业人员不具终身前提学习的战斗能力,才能不被加速其发展的原先技术垫底。而现有多数前沿的原先技术、原先方的第一手材料都是用英文名称撰写下的,所以学习者英文名称原版技术资料是计数机工程师必备的战斗能力之一。IT、互联网层面的多数尾部大公司都对求职者的英文名称学习者角度看或多或少敦促。

甲级考生一般有 4道墨迹,其中的,前两墨迹的分数为 20分和 25分,素材与乙级考生的后两墨迹完全相同,即乙级考生终于两墨迹的英文名称版,在此才会赘述。后两墨迹的分数为 25分和 30分,互换考生纲要中的内部战斗能力的实地考察。

甲级考生特有的实地考察点都是计数机专业根基文凭“数据资料构造”的内部素材。对于计数机相关专业的教职员而言,在课堂上了所求到这些方点的界定也就是说都有就不具了运用这些方所求决单单问墨迹的战斗能力。而 PAT的特点就是实地考察笔试运用方透过实战程序内部设计的战斗能力。

对数据资料构造方的实地考察集中的在两边 25分墨迹和两道 30分墨迹上,这三墨迹道通常时会分别就其线性表、树是、所示这三大内部素材,以及围绕它们展开的精华启发式。25分墨迹与 30分墨迹纤现的平衡性区别主要纤现在两个尺度:一是程序内部设计使用量,二是线性。

总能的 30分墨迹一般有两种显现出墨迹表现手法:一种故称“难死你”,即内部设计显现出巧妙极低效的差评所求墨迹启发式是一件比较困难的事,笔试的时长时会主要兰总成本在最初启发式上,而一旦想道通了,程序内部设计使用量单单上也就是说大;另一种故称“繁死你”, 即运用于的启发式很容易知道,但要想合理构建,却不是一件最简单的事情,笔试的时长时会主要兰总成本在编著和复用编译器上。

例墨迹 1实地考察树是的相关系统内部设计,仅限于根据读取的每个结点的左右孩兄E组织起来一棵树是,并能用后序结点输显现出后缀formula_。墨迹目实地考察的方点比较单一,编译器使用量适中的,是两道类似的 25分墨迹。

很明显,例墨迹 2实地考察的是所示的最粗壮路径问墨迹,并且加入了一些额之外必需,实地考察笔试究竟都能对启发式透过轻巧能用。墨迹目实地考察的启发式比较精华且极易知道,但程序内部设计时无需全面性考虑到各种细节必需的妥善处理,加速得到差评是不容易算是的,这就是两道类似的 30分墨迹。

例墨迹 3看上去是关于栈的墨迹目,但显然 PeekMedian这个多种相同系统内部设计的构建很有细密。笔试必需想必要把这个多种相同系统内部设计的时长线性控制到拟合,例如可以运用于树是状构造“填”辅助所求决问墨迹。本墨迹目无需笔试对一个很难现成所求决方案的问墨迹透过归纳,兰花时长找显现出拟合启发式,这是另一种类似的 30分墨迹。

与乙级考生相对于,甲级考生是从平衡性第二大的 20分墨迹跟上的,再继续次提极低了投球的下限。乙级考生能得到 90分的笔试,在甲级考生中的一般可以得到 60分以上的总分。

甲级考生敦促笔试不仅时会写下服务器端,而且要时会写下“好”的服务器端,即必需辅以合适的数据资料磁盘方法,运用于最极低效的启发式所求决不够适合于的问墨迹。甲级总分出色说明了笔试不仅根基扎实、头脑轻巧、动手战斗能力爆冷,而且英文名称学习者战斗能力也不错,道通常时会不够颇受大公司的赞赏。

4

顶级考生纲要阐释

顶级考生互换“佛祖”八段,在甲级考生的细化,还全面性实地考察笔试的都有战斗能力:

把握低级、适合于数据资料构造的用法并能精准常用,如后缀嵌套、树是状嵌套、圆圈树是、 Treap、静态 KDTree等;

都能利用精华启发式思想所求决较难的启发式问墨迹,如动态规划、计数拓扑学、所示论低级运用(仅限于第二大流水 /成比例割、爆冷连道通共同点、近来公共祖先、成比例转换成树是、欧拉核苷酸)等,并能轻巧能用;

都能所求决适合于的精心内部设计问墨迹,编著并复用编译器使用量不大的服务器端;

很强缜密的科学思维,考虑到问墨迹周全,都能合理考虑到适合于问墨迹的边境线情况。

顶级考生一般只有 3道墨迹,其中的,第一墨迹的分数为 30分,素材与甲级考生中的总能的一墨迹完全相同,在此才会赘述。后两墨迹的分数均为 35分,互换考生纲要中的对内部战斗能力的实地考察。

顶级考生是为尾部大公司甄选战斗能力显现出众的人才而内部设计的,只配合大公司的秋招和春招开设考生,严寒 PAT很难特设顶级考生。从考生纲要可以看显现出,顶级考生的实地考察以内最少了绝大多数极低校“数据资料构造”“启发式归纳”类文凭的教学纲要,并且墨迹目描绘也常用英文名称。从 2015年三场举办以来,每年参加顶级考生的笔试分之一仅占笔试总数的 1%,都能得到好总分的笔试不够是凤毛麟角。

在考生纲要列显现出的不乏方点中的,动态规划和所示论低级运用是最常实地考察的素材,道通常显现显现出来在平衡性相对高于的 35分墨迹中的,终于两道 35分墨迹一般就其多个方点的融时会贯道通。

例墨迹 1显然是一个求三长简约兄核苷酸问墨迹的反转。三长简约兄核苷酸问墨迹有精华的动态规划所求出,此墨迹敦促笔试能在精华启发式的细化做轻巧改动,从而得到三长的峰型兄核苷酸。

例墨迹 2是关于统计当此集合的问墨迹,有很多相同的所求出。墨迹目敦促笔试能自己计算出来显现出兄嵌套当此转前后当此集合的变化规律,并且配上树是状嵌套或者圆圈树是等用以以提极低构建的成本。

与甲级考生相对于,顶级考生是从 30分墨迹跟上的,并且多数方点也就是说时会在一般极低校的课堂中的讲授,这极大地提极低了投球的下限。甲级考生能得到 90分的笔试,在顶级考生中的也就是说能得到 60分以上的总分。

另一方面,对于参加计数机界顶级启发式赛程(如国际大教职员服务器端内部设计竞赛)的选手而言,顶级考生的墨迹目一般等同于中的等偏上的平衡性,虽然有“闭卷 +独立已完成”这两个敦促,在一定某种程度上提极低了平衡性,但有战力的选手要想得到差评也也就是说是一个极低不可攀的能够。

对于尾部大公司而言,顶级考生纲要中的列显现出的这些低级数据资料构造与启发式也就是说一定在主观的工程项目中的有太多运用,但大公司仍然乐于实地考察这些方,只是因为顶级总分能得到出色说明了笔试除了不具超爆冷的启发式战斗能力之外,还很强极爆冷的进取心和自学战斗能力,很强成为出色计数机工程师的爆冷大潜力。

范例讲所求

计数机服务器端内部设计战斗能力考生(PAT)

改定道通

精彩回顾

1. PAT的特设与规则

下期官方网站

3. PAT精心内部设计样墨迹(最简单墨迹)

4. PAT精心内部设计样墨迹(进阶墨迹)

5. PAT精心内部设计样墨迹(提升墨迹)

6. PAT精心内部设计样墨迹(难墨迹)

5

参看书籍

《计数机服务器端内部设计战斗能力考生(PAT)改定道通》

PAT创设的初衷是诸般“亦非高校显现出身论”的职场兼职歧视,旨在为广大学兄共享一个不道德、公正的求职跟上平台。PAT的自由联盟大公司均承诺为达到分数线敦促的笔试共享兼职时的优先机时会。

作者:陈越、戴龙衷

价格:60元

扫码优惠余卷

什么药治疗打呼噜最好
必奇蒙脱石散治疗拉肚子效果怎么样
再林阿莫西林颗粒能不能治疗感冒
喉咙痛吃什么药有效
新冠可以吃什么药
友情链接